Common/IniFile: Make use of std::string_view where applicable

Now that the std::map less-than comparitor is capable of being used with
heterogenous lookup, we're able to convert many of the querying
functions that took std::string references over to std::string_view.

Now these functions may be used without potentially allocating a
std::string instance unnecessarily.
